2. Important Materials

The stuff your gear is made of really matters.

  • Canvas: This is a strong, natural material. It breathes well, which helps stop condensation. Some canvas is treated to be waterproof.
  • Nylon and Polyester: These are strong, lightweight synthetic fabrics. They are often used for tents and covers because they are water-resistant and dry quickly.
  • Aluminum: This metal is light but strong. It’s used for tent poles and frames.
  • Foam: Good foam makes for a comfy sleeping surface. Look for dense foam that won’t flatten out too easily.

3. What Makes a Setup Great (or Not So Great)

A few things can make your truck camping experience much better or worse.

Things That Improve Quality:
  • Good Seams: Strong, well-stitched seams help keep water out and make your gear last longer.
  • UV Protection: Some fabrics have special coatings to protect them from the sun’s rays. This stops the material from fading and getting weak.
  • Ventilation: Good airflow stops your tent from getting stuffy and wet inside.
  • Easy Access: Being able to get in and out of your truck bed easily is a big plus.
Things That Reduce Quality:
  • Cheap Zippers: Flimsy zippers can break easily and make it hard to open and close things.
  • Thin Materials: Thin fabrics might not protect you well from the weather or wear out quickly.
  • Poor Design: If the setup is hard to put up or doesn’t fit your truck bed well, it’s not a good choice.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is the most important feature for truck camping?

A: Comfort is key. You need a good sleeping surface to get a restful night’s sleep.

Q: Are canvas truck tents better than nylon ones?

A: Canvas is more breathable and can be quieter in the wind. Nylon is lighter and dries faster.

Q: How do I keep my truck camping setup dry?

A: Look for waterproof materials and sealed seams. Make sure your setup fits your truck bed snugly.

Q: Can I use a regular air mattress in my truck bed?

A: Yes, but truck bed specific mattresses are often designed to fit the shape of the bed better and are more durable.

Q: What kind of storage solutions are good for truck camping?

A: Look for integrated storage bins or organizers that fit your truck bed. You can also use duffel bags and plastic bins.

Q: Is it hard to set up a truck camping tent?

A: Most modern truck camping tents are designed for quick and easy setup, often taking only a few minutes.

Q: What should I consider if I camp in different weather conditions?

A: You’ll need good insulation for cold weather and ventilation for hot weather. Waterproofing is important for rain.

Q: How much weight can a truck camping setup hold?

A: This varies greatly by product. Always check the manufacturer’s weight limit for your specific setup.

Q: Can I cook inside my truck camping setup?

A: It is generally not safe to cook inside any tent due to fire risk and carbon monoxide. Always cook in a well-ventilated area outside.
